## Deployment

The Petalframe thumbnail queue runs as a single worker pool per region, pulling jobs from the shared broker and writing renders to the media store. Deploys are rolling: drain one worker, wait for in-flight jobs to finish (usually under thirty seconds), then replace it. Never scale to zero during business hours, since upload bursts will back the queue up quickly and the UI shows broken placeholders. If queue depth alarms fire, check broker health before scaling. The pool starts with these settings:

service settings:
PRAIX_LOG_LEVEL=error
PRAIX_METRICS_HOST=metrics.praix.qorvelcorp.corp
PRAIX_POOL_SIZE=16

## Env Vars: Bulk Edits in Admin Table

Quick notes for the sync. The Quillbarn admin table now supports bulk edits on environment variables. Select rows, hit Apply, changes propagate to staging pods within 60s. No per-row confirmation anymore — double-check scope before applying. Rollback is one click, keeps last three snapshots. Audit log lands in the Ferndeck channel. Prod edits still gated behind Marla's approval flow. Bulk edits require the service token to be present, so each environment file must include the following line.

secret setting of kahif-bagep: VAULT_KEY29=2dc5e8284b5a3e9e278f4ba0906fc

## Escalation

If the Korvex hermetic migration breaks the nightly build, do not revert the toolchain pin. Check the sandbox cache first; stale seeds cause 80% of failures. Page the Buildfarm rotation only if binaries differ across two clean runs. For anything toolchain-related after hours, escalate directly to the migration lead.

alerts address for kajog-tadup: druox@plorvanet.internal

### PR: Saner retry windows for the Nightjar backfill scheduler

Quick one before the sync — Nightjar kept stampeding the warehouse when a backfill slipped past 2am, because every shard retried on the same tick. This PR adds per-shard jitter, a hard cap on concurrent backfills, and a cooldown after two consecutive failures. No behavior change for on-time runs. Values were picked from last month's load tests; the new scheduler constants are below.

tuning table, hafog-bahaf:
QUOTAS = {
    "praion": 144,
    "briax": 906,
    "silwyn": 451,
}